Embed climate adaptation into teaching and learning

Bring local climate data and your climate adaptation work into teaching and learning. This can help make learning about climate more meaningful for children and young people.

Use local climate data in the curriculum

Find ways to incorporate local weather patterns, temperature trends, and climate-related events into your setting's educational activities and wider teaching and learning. This includes teaching about seasonal changes, weather phenomena, and how these factors affect their environment. Use hooks identified in your curriculum audit to find relevant placement.

Integrate your climate adaptation aims in your teaching and learning

Find ways to link climate adaptation aims and initiatives into your setting's teaching and learning. This action can be adapted to all settings. For example, water conservation can be taught through formal learning, as well as through non-statutory studies, wider skills, character education, play or extra-curricular activities.
